Building your own dream house instead of buying an existing one has several advantages. One of the most significant benefits is the ability to customize every aspect of the home to your exact specifications, from the layout to the materials and finishes used. 

Advantages of Building a Home

Additionally, new homes built with modern construction techniques and materials are often more energy-efficient, which can mean lower utility bills and a smaller environmental footprint. Because new homes require less maintenance than older ones, building a new home can also mean fewer repair costs and less hassle over time. 

Another advantage is that you can design your home to meet your current and future needs, which means you won’t have to undertake expensive renovations to accommodate changes in your lifestyle or family size.

Building a home can be a deeply rewarding experience that provides a sense of pride in knowing that you created a space that perfectly suits your needs and reflects your personal style. 

While building a home can be a significant undertaking and requires more involvement in the design and construction process than buying an existing home, it can be the best option for those looking for a home that is tailored to their exact needs and preferences.

10 Steps for Building a Dream Home You’ll Love

Here are ten steps to help you build a home you’ll fall in love with. 

1) Create a clear vision:

Start by imagining what you want your home to look like and how you want to feel when you’re in it. Make a list of the features and amenities that are most important to you, such as the number of bedrooms and bathrooms, the layout of the kitchen and living spaces, and any special features like a home office or outdoor living area.

2) Choose the right location: 

The location of your home is important for many reasons, including proximity to work and other amenities, access to good schools, and the overall quality of life in the community. Choose a location that meets your needs and aligns with your lifestyle and values.

3) Work with an experienced builder

Building a home is a complex and challenging process, so it’s important to work with an experienced builder who can help you bring your vision to life. Look for a builder with a good reputation, experience building the type of home you want, and a commitment to quality and customer satisfaction.

4) Make smart design choices: 

From the floor plan to the finishes, the design of your home is critical to its overall look and feel. Work with your builder to choose design elements that reflect your personal style and create a functional and comfortable living space. Consider factors like lighting, color, and texture when making your choices.

5) Focus on energy efficiency: 

Building a home that is energy efficient can help you save money on utility bills and reduce your carbon footprint. Look for ways to incorporate energy-efficient features, such as high-efficiency windows, insulation, and HVAC systems, into your design.

6) Pay attention to the details: 

Small details can have a big impact on the overall look and feel of your home. Consider details like door handles, light fixtures, and hardware that can add character and style to your space.

7) Think about storage: 

Having enough storage space is critical for a functional and organized home. Work with your builder to incorporate ample storage into your design, including closets, pantries, and other storage solutions.

8) Plan for outdoor living:

If you enjoy spending time outdoors, consider incorporating outdoor living spaces into your design. This can include a patio, deck, or outdoor kitchen that provides a connection to nature and allows you to enjoy the great outdoors in comfort.

9) Incorporate sustainable materials: 

Using sustainable and environmentally friendly materials can have a positive impact on both the environment and your budget. Look for materials like low-VOC paints, bamboo flooring, and recycled glass countertops that are both eco-friendly and durable.

10) Consider the layout: 

The layout of your home can have a big impact on its functionality and livability. Work with your builder to create a layout that is practical, efficient, and designed with your lifestyle in mind.

By following these steps, you can create a home that is both beautiful and functional and that you will fall in love with for years to come. Building a home is a big investment, so take the time to plan carefully and choose the right team to help bring your vision to life.
